Transaction 210ab203bacc688d378bcb02871c8d38a947246b05f9503aa6431df006877855
1 Input
1 Output
-
210ab203bacc688d378bcb02871c8d38a947246b05f9503aa6431df006877855:0
- value
- 889754
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f386879c3238c7d0e44d2f6ce3fcdf6a225801f
- address
- bc1q3uuxs7wrywx86rjy6tmvu07d763ztqql88crcc